Purpose of the role

To design, develop, and execute testing strategies to validate functionality, performance, and user experience, while collaborating with cross-functional teams to identify and resolve defects, and continuously improve testing processes and methodologies, to ensure software quality and reliability. 

Accountabilities

  • Development and implementation of comprehensive test plans and strategies to validate software functionality and ensure compliance with established quality standards.
  • Creation and execution automated test scripts, leveraging testing frameworks and tools to facilitate early detection of defects and quality issues.         .
  • Collaboration with cross-functional teams to analyse requirements, participate in design discussions, and contribute to the development of acceptance criteria, ensuring a thorough understanding of the software being tested.
  • Root cause analysis for identified defects, working closely with developers to provide detailed information and support defect resolution.
  • Collaboration with peers, participate in code reviews, and promote a culture of code quality and knowledge sharing.
  • Stay informed of industry technology trends and innovations, and actively contribute to the organization's technology communities to foster a culture of technical excellence and growth.

To be successful as a Test Engineer, you should have:

  • Considerable test design and execution experience, writing clear test plans and test cases, and performing both manual and automated testing to validate features and identify defects

  • Ample automation skills, with proficiency in test automation frameworks and CI/CD integration to create reliable and maintainable test suites

  • Technical troubleshooting and debugging capabilities, with an understanding of system architecture, ability to read logs, reproduce issues, and collaborate with developers to isolate root causes

  • Quality focused on communication and collaboration, clearly documenting defects, reporting test results, and coordinating with product, development, and QA teams to prioritize fixes

  • An analytical mindset and commitment to continuous improvement, using metrics, risk-based testing, and test data management to enhance coverage and testing efficiency, while adapting to new tools and processes

Other highly valued skills include:

  • Test automation experience with Selenium, Cypress, and Appium, building reliable and maintainable test suites

  • Programming and scripting experience in ReactJS, Node.js, Python, Java, MongoDB, and SQL, creating tests, tools, and test data

  • CI/CD and DevOps experience using Jenkins and GitHub Actions to integrate automated tests into delivery pipelines

  • API and backend testing skills with REST and Postman, validating services and contracts

  • Considerable debugging and root-cause analysis abilities, reproducing issues, reading logs and traces, and collaborating with teams to resolve defects

What We Do

Barclays is a British universal bank. We are diversified by business, by different types of customers and clients, and by geography. Our businesses include consumer banking and payments operations around the world, as well as a top-tier, full service, global corporate and investment bank, all of which are supported by our service company which provides technology, operations and functional services across the Group. With over 325 years of history and expertise in banking, Barclays operates in over 40 countries and employs approximately 83,500 people. Barclays moves, lends, invests and protects money for customers and clients worldwide.
